Common Mistakes to Avoid When Using Stainless Steel Measuring Cups
Okay, we’ve covered the benefits and maintenance of stainless steel measuring cups. Now, let’s delve into some common pitfalls to avoid to ensure accurate and consistent results in your culinary endeavors. Imagine you are baking and your cake comes out flat. Could be you didn’t properly measure your ingredients. Using the wrong measuring technique can throw off your entire recipe, especially when precision is key.
Ever found yourself scooping flour directly from the bag with your measuring cup? While it might seem like the quickest method, it can lead to inaccuracies. Scooping compresses the flour, resulting in a higher concentration than intended. Instead, use a spoon to lightly fluff the flour and then spoon it into the measuring cup. Level off the excess with a straight edge for a more accurate measurement.
Another common mistake is using the same measuring cup for both wet and dry ingredients without properly cleaning it in between. Residue from one ingredient can contaminate the next, altering the flavor and texture of your dish. Imagine using a measuring cup that previously contained oil to measure out flour. The residual oil can affect the gluten development, leading to a tough and chewy result.
Finally, always double-check the markings on your measuring cups to ensure they are clearly visible and accurate. Over time, the markings can fade or become obscured, leading to mismeasurements. This is particularly important when following recipes that require precise measurements. A faded marking of 1/2 cup could easily be mistaken for 1/3 cup, with disastrous consequences for your recipe.
Expanding Your Measuring Arsenal: Beyond the Basics
So, you’ve mastered the art of using your stainless steel measuring cups. What’s next? It’s time to explore the world of specialized measuring tools that can take your cooking and baking to the next level. Imagine needing to measure a tiny amount of spice for an exotic dish. Relying on your standard measuring cups might result in an overwhelming flavor. This is where measuring spoons come in handy.
Consider investing in a set of measuring spoons made from, you guessed it, stainless steel! These smaller tools are perfect for measuring spices, extracts, and other ingredients that require precise measurements. They’re also ideal for adding small amounts of baking powder or soda to your recipes, ensuring the perfect rise and texture.
Another essential tool for any serious cook or baker is a kitchen scale. While measuring cups are great for volume measurements, a scale provides accurate weight measurements, which are often more precise, especially in baking. Think about measuring flour – a cup of flour can vary significantly in weight depending on how it’s packed. A kitchen scale eliminates this variability, ensuring consistent results every time.
Finally, don’t underestimate the power of liquid measuring cups. While you can technically use dry measuring cups for liquids, liquid measuring cups are designed with a spout for easy pouring and clear markings for accurate measurements. They’re also typically made from heat-resistant materials, making them ideal for measuring hot liquids like melted butter or broth.

Material Quality: Not All Stainless Steel is Created Equal
So, you’re thinking stainless steel, right? Great choice! But hold on a sec, because “stainless steel” is a broad term. You want to make sure you’re getting a high-quality stainless steel that’s going to last. The type of stainless steel used directly impacts the durability, resistance to rust, and overall lifespan of your measuring cups. Lower grade stainless steel can pit, rust, or even react with acidic foods over time.
Look for 18/8 or 304 stainless steel. This means the steel contains 18% chromium and 8% nickel. This combination provides excellent corrosion resistance and makes the cups food-safe and durable. It’s the gold standard for kitchenware and what you’ll want to aim for when selecting the best stainless steel measuring cups. Cup Sizes and Completeness: Getting the Right Set for Your Recipes
Think about your cooking and baking habits. Do you mostly bake cakes that require very precise measurements? Or are you more of a “wing it” kind of cook? The sizes included in a set of measuring cups matter a lot! A basic set usually includes 1 cup, ½ cup, ⅓ cup, and ¼ cup. But some sets go above and beyond, offering sizes like ⅔ cup, ⅛ cup, and even specialty sizes like 1 ½ cup.
Consider what you typically measure. If you frequently double or halve recipes, having cups that accommodate those calculations directly will save you time and effort. Also, check if the set includes corresponding measuring spoons. A coordinated set of both cups and spoons can really elevate your kitchen game. Handle Design: Comfort and Functionality Matter
You might not think much about the handles of measuring cups, but trust me, they can make a huge difference! Imagine trying to scoop flour with a cup that has a tiny, uncomfortable handle. Not fun, right? Look for handles that are comfortable to grip and hold, even when your hands are wet or sticky.
Ideally, the handles should be long enough to provide a secure grip and prevent your fingers from touching the contents of the cup. Some handles are ergonomically designed for added comfort. Also, consider whether the handles are riveted or welded to the cup. Welded handles are generally smoother and easier to clean, while riveted handles can be more durable in the long run. Measurement Markings: Clear, Durable, and Easy to Read
Imagine using your measuring cups and the measurements are fading or rubbing off! Frustrating, right? The measurement markings are a crucial aspect of the functionality of measuring cups. You need to be able to clearly and easily read the measurements, even after repeated use and washing.
Look for cups with measurements that are either engraved directly into the stainless steel or stamped with a durable, long-lasting ink. Avoid cups with painted markings, as these are more likely to fade or chip over time. Also, consider the size and font of the markings. Are they large enough and clear enough for you to read easily? What are the benefits of having both dry and liquid measuring cups?
While you could technically use the same stainless steel measuring cups for both dry and liquid ingredients, having dedicated sets can actually be quite beneficial! Dry measuring cups are designed to be filled to the brim and leveled off, ensuring accurate measurements for things like flour and sugar.
Liquid measuring cups, on the other hand, are typically made of clear material with easy-to-read markings on the side. This allows you to accurately measure liquids by viewing them at eye level. Using the right type of cup for the right ingredient will lead to more consistent and successful recipes!
